Breaking Bad star
Dean Norris is all of the sudden on board for
Ridley Scott‘s upcoming project titled
The Counselor. Say what you want, but this guy will definitely have some great company, because so far this movie also stars
Michael Fassbender, Brad Pitt, Javier Bardem, Penelope Cruz and
Cameron Diaz.
So, as you already know, The Counselor is the story written by Cormac McCarthy and centers on an attorney who attempts to get into the drug business. Fassbender will play that attorney, while Cruz is on board to play his girlfriend, character named Laura.
On the other hand, we have Bardem as criminal Reiner who has an interesting business proposition for Fassbender's character: they'll take $20 million worth of cocaine from south of the border and offload it themselves, aided by Westray, played by Pitt. Diaz, quite logically, stars as character named Malkina, who hooks up with Reiner.
As for Norris' role – fortunately or unfortunately – still no details.
